If you are driving through the Mexico border all the way to Cancun you'll need certain travel documents, including a valid passport book. However, those who arrive and depart by land or by sea don't need a passport book. Rather, you can use the significantly cheaper passport card. It's about the size of a driver's license and is valid for land ...

Jan 28, 2024 · A passport card is considerably less than a booklet and is accepted in travel destinations like Mexico, Bermuda, the Caribbean, and Canada. It is still necessary to carry the registration form (FMM) and everybody else in your car. Driving to Cancun, drivers must bring a driver's license (or better yet, acquire an International Driving License). All flight travelers to Cancun must have a valid passport. Unlike road travel, where you can use either a passport card or a book, air travel requires a valid passport book. Minors are also covered by this rule. When touring with minors, have notarized consent paperwork from their parents or guardians on hand.

You’ll need to obtain a Forma Migratoria Multiple, or FMM, when you enter Mexico if planning to go outside of the 35 kilometer free zone.On April 1rst the tourist authorities announced that foreign visitors arriving in the Mexican Caribbean will have to pay a tax. The new payment is mandatory for all foreign tourists over 15 years old entering Quintana Roo state. Tourists can pay before their arrival, during their stay, or upon exiting the state via a new website called Visitax.US Citizens are eligible to travel to Cancun visa-free.
